Massive Bio and Optellum Collaborate to Accelerate Clinical Trial Access for Early-Stage Non-Small Cell Lung Cancer Patients

AI-powered lung cancer risk detection meets precision oncology trial matching - connecting high-risk patients to potentially life-saving research at the earliest, most treatable stage

BOCA RATON, Fla.--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Massive Bio, a global leader in AI-driven precision oncology and clinical trial matching operating across 17+ countries, and Optellum, the leader in AI-enabled lung cancer diagnosis and the developer of the world’s first FDA-cleared clinical decision support software for early-stage lung cancer, today announced a collaboration to bridge early lung cancer detection with clinical trial access for patients with non-small cell lung cancer (NSCLC).

The collaboration represents a first-of-its-kind integration of Optellum’s clinically validated Lung Cancer Prediction (LCP) AI, which helps clinicians to surface high-risk lung nodule patients - with Massive Bio’s AI-powered clinical trial matching platform, which matches patients to active clinical trials and delivers actionable, physician-targeted reports. Together, the two companies aim to ensure that patients identified at high risk during routine imaging are not only diagnosed earlier but are promptly considered for clinical trials that could expand their treatment options.

From Early Detection to Trial Access - Without Delay

Lung cancer remains the leading cause of cancer-related death worldwide. While early-stage detection dramatically improves outcomes - five-year survival rates rise from 9% at late-stage diagnosis to 64% when caught early - most patients who are flagged at high risk still never reach clinical trials. The gap between a high-risk imaging finding and an active trial referral remains one of the most consequential missed opportunities in oncology.

“For the first time, we can close the loop between a high-risk CT finding and a relevant clinical trial referral - in real time, and at scale. NSCLC patients flagged by Optellum’s LCP AI are some of the most time-sensitive candidates for clinical research: they’ve been identified early, before the window for curative-intent options closes. Our collaboration ensures that their physicians receive the right trial information, in the right geography, at exactly the right moment in the care journey.”

- Arturo Loaiza-Bonilla, MD, MSEd, FACP, Chief Medical AI Officer, Massive Bio

Under this collaboration, Optellum’s AI platform automatically analyzes reported radiology findings and CT cases to help clinicians to surface high-risk lung cancer patients - specifically those flagged at elevated risk before a formal diagnosis is confirmed. These de-identified patient signals are then processed by Massive Bio’s AI platform, which matches patient profiles to geographically accessible, active NSCLC clinical trials and delivers actionable reports directly to treating physicians.

The result is a seamless, privacy-assured workflow that connects early detection with trial access, keeping patient review, referral and trial participation under the control of treating physicians and participating sites, without requiring sites, patients or physicians to navigate the process independently.

About Optellum

Optellum is a commercial-stage AI healthcare company dedicated to revolutionizing early diagnosis and treatment of lung disease, starting with one of the deadliest, lung cancer. Optellum's flagship product, Virtual Nodule Clinic (VNC) with Lung Cancer Prediction AI (LCP), is the world's first FDA-cleared and reimbursed software-as-a-medical-device (SaMD) solution for AI-powered lung cancer prioritization and diagnostic support. Clinicians trust the Optellum solution to aid them in making the most appropriate life-saving treatment decisions for their patients. Backed by real-world clinical evidence, Optellum's solution accelerates the diagnostic care pathway by enabling early patient identification, enhancing prioritization, and improving clinicians' efficiency, reducing time to guideline-recommended treatment. Optellum VNC is FDA cleared, CE-MDR marked, TGA approved, and UKCA marked with CMS reimbursement of $650 under CPT codes, 0721T and 0722T.Optellum is headquartered in Oxford, UK, and has an office in Houston, Texas, US.
